The Early Days of Artificial Intelligence in Chess

The idea of computers playing chess fascinated researchers long before modern AI systems existed. During the 1950s and 1960s, scientists began developing early chess programs capable of calculating moves and evaluating positions using basic rules.

Although these early chess engines were limited, they laid the foundation for one of the biggest technological revolutions in chess history.

The turning point came in 1997 when Garry Kasparov faced IBM’s Deep Blue in a historic match. Kasparov, widely regarded as one of the greatest chess players of all time, lost to a computer, marking a major milestone in artificial intelligence and computer-assisted decision-making.

At the time, many people viewed the event as a battle between humans and machines. In reality, it marked the beginning of a new era where AI would eventually become a powerful training partner for chess players around the world.

How AI Changed Chess Preparation

Before AI-powered chess engines became widely available, players relied heavily on books, manual game analysis, and hours of work with coaches to improve their understanding.

Today, AI chess engines can instantly evaluate positions, detect tactical opportunities, uncover strategic mistakes, and recommend stronger alternatives within seconds.

Modern chess software such as Stockfish and Leela Chess Zero has dramatically elevated the standard of chess preparation at every level.

Stockfish is one of the world’s strongest open-source chess engines, known for its deep calculation abilities and accurate evaluations. Leela Chess Zero uses neural-network-based learning inspired by AlphaZero, allowing it to develop highly creative and unconventional positional ideas.

Here are some of the biggest ways AI in chess has transformed training and improvement:

Faster Game Analysis

Players can now upload their games to chess platforms and receive instant evaluations. AI engines quickly identify blunders, inaccuracies, missed tactics, and stronger move alternatives.

This type of AI-powered chess analysis helps players improve much faster than traditional manual review methods.

Better Opening Preparation

Opening databases combined with chess AI allow players to prepare deeply against opponents and discover new opening ideas.

Professional chess players extensively use engines before tournaments to refine opening preparation and explore advanced variations. Consistently before tournaments.

Personalized Learning

Modern AI-powered chess coaching systems can identify weaknesses in a player’s style and recommend personalized puzzles, openings, endgame exercises, and study plans.

This makes online chess learning more efficient and targeted.

Improved Tactical Training

AI-generated tactical exercises adapt to a player’s skill level and learning progress. This creates a more effective and engaging training experience compared to static puzzle collections.

AI and the Rise of Online Chess

The rapid growth of online chess platforms has also been fueled by artificial intelligence.

Features such as automated game reviews, adaptive lessons, puzzle recommendations, performance tracking, and smart learning systems rely heavily on AI technology.

During the global online chess boom, millions of players gained access to tools that were once available only to elite grandmasters and professional coaches. Today, even beginners can analyze games with world-class accuracy directly from a smartphone.

This accessibility has accelerated chess improvement worldwide. Young players are reaching advanced levels earlier because they now have constant access to high-quality AI-driven chess training tools.

AI vs Human Chess Understanding

One of the most discussed topics in modern chess is whether AI reduces human creativity.

Some critics argue that players have become too dependent on engine evaluations and computer-generated preparation. However, many top players believe artificial intelligence has actually expanded creative possibilities in chess.

Neural-network chess engines often recommend unconventional sacrifices, positional concepts, and long-term strategic ideas that humans previously overlooked.

Rather than making chess robotic, AI has introduced fresh perspectives into the game.

While AI can calculate millions of positions within seconds, human players still rely on intuition, psychology, emotional control, and practical decision-making during real games.

The strongest chess improvement often comes from combining human understanding with AI-assisted analysis.

Frequently Asked Questions About AI in Chess

How does AI help chess players improve?

AI helps players analyze games, identify mistakes, practice tactics, improve openings, and receive personalized training recommendations.

What are the best AI chess engines?

Some of the most popular chess engines include Stockfish, Leela Chess Zero, and neural-network systems inspired by AlphaZero.

Can beginners use AI for chess training?

Yes. Modern AI-powered chess platforms make learning easier for beginners through adaptive lessons, automated analysis, and personalized recommendations.

Will AI replace chess coaches?

AI can support coaching, but experienced human coaches remain essential for strategic understanding, motivation, and practical improvement.
